Thathar - Haripur, Kangra
Thathar is a village situated in the Haripur tehsil of Kangra district, Himachal Pradesh. It is located approximately 44 km from Dharmsala. Tripal serves as the Gram Panchayat for Thathar village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Thathar is 010336. The village covers a total geographical area of 105.68 hectares and falls under the 176029 pincode. Dera Gopipur is the nearest town.
Thathar village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Dehra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Hamirpur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Thathar
According to the 2011 Census, Thathar village had a total population of 580 people, including 270 males and 310 females, living in 131 households. The sex ratio was 1,148 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 86.78%, with male literacy at 92.83% and female literacy at 81.75%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 120.
The table below presents a detailed demographic breakdown of the village, including separate male and female figures for each population category.
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 580 | 270 | 310 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 58 | 33 | 25 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 120 | 62 | 58 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 0 | 0 | 0 |
| Literate Population | 453 | 220 | 233 |
| Illiterate Population | 127 | 50 | 77 |

Transport and Connectivity of Thathar
Thathar is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ared van services. The nearest railway station is located within >10 km of Thathar.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within <5 km |
| Private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Railway Station | No | Available within >10 km |
